An Indian Air Force LCA Tejas Mk1 crashed during an aerial manoeuvre at the Dubai Airshow on Friday. The incident occurred on the final day of the biennial event at Al Maktoum International Airport. The crash came a day after the Press Information Bureau (PIB) fact-check unit debunked social media claims of an "oil leakage" from a Tejas aircraft at the airshow.
On November 20, the PIB addressed circulating videos alleging technical issues with the LCA Tejas Mk1, stating, "Several propaganda accounts are circulating videos claiming that at the Dubai Airshow 2025, the Indian LCA Tejas Mk1 suffered oil leakage. These claims are fake".
The "propaganda videos" claimed that "oil was leaking" from one of the fighter jets.
